An entertaining and complete tour of the Chilean mountains, with stops for panoramic views and a visit to Parque Farellones. A place located in the Farellones Mountain Center, which invites you to live a day full of adventure and adrenaline in its different attractions.

The Park is divided into three zones: Base Sector, Intermediate Zone and Summit, in all areas you will find games and activities such as tubing on 250-meter tracks, the largest canopy in the area, a panoramic chair to take a walk through the heights, Tray Sled, one of the children’s favorites.

Perfect snow introduction - This was my first experience with real snow, and it was unforgettable. Much of it was thanks to our guide, Luciano, and driver, Mario. They were extremely kind and attentive. The road to the park includes 40 very steep curves, which might make some people feel sick. During our tour, a little girl felt uneasy and Luciano and Mario were perfect: they looked for a safe place to make a stop, attended to the little girl's family, and only when everything was OK, they summarized the road. Luciano gave clear instructions about the park attractions, and food facilities and was reachable throughout the entire time. Mario was a careful driver, both going up and down the mountain. They also left us closer to our hotel than the original endpoint and gave us clear instructions to return. The park is organized, ideal for kids of all ages, and perfect if you have no experience with snow sports, but want to learn. Restrooms were clean, and there was room for people who wanted to rest. There are food trucks all along the park and even my husband, who needs a gluten-free meal could find something to eat. There are attractions for everyone, excellent infrastructure, and a gorgeous place. The only thing I would change is the loud music in the main attraction area. It is unnecessary, and prevents you from listening to the sounds of nature (but that's my personal opinion). Will definitely be back!
